Transaction 63c23d54efad201ad5cb9a80fbc4acf7947c1bef841e83dee6c1a9eec104e6cd
1 Input
1 Output
-
63c23d54efad201ad5cb9a80fbc4acf7947c1bef841e83dee6c1a9eec104e6cd:0
- value
- 2420690
- script pubkey
- OP_0 OP_PUSHBYTES_20 eeb33e992124665883a9bf0f2db2760dd7c7de20
- address
- bc1qa6enaxfpy3n93qafhu8jmvnkphtu0h3quft873